Understanding Sack Gabions
Sack gabions are essentially large bags or sacks made from durable geotextile material that can be filled with natural aggregates, such as sand, gravel, or local stone. These flexible structures can be stacked or arranged in various configurations, making them suitable for a wide range of applications, from erosion control to landscaping and architectural features.
One of the key advantages of sack gabions is their ability to adapt to different terrains and conditions. They can be easily transported and deployed in remote locations, making them an ideal solution for emergency repairs after natural disasters like floods or landslides. Furthermore, the use of natural materials within sack gabions enhances their environmental compatibility, promoting sustainability within construction practices.

Applications of Sack Gabions
The versatility of sack gabions has allowed them to be applied in various sectors, including civil engineering, landscaping, and even art. In erosion control projects, sack gabions can be strategically placed along riverbanks or slopes to prevent soil displacement and sedimentation. In landscaping, they serve as attractive, eco-friendly retaining walls or decorative features.
In civil engineering, sack gabions are often utilized in flood control systems, offering a cost-effective solution for managing water flow and protecting infrastructure. Their flexibility allows engineers to design systems that can withstand shifting conditions, making them an invaluable resource in regions prone to flooding.
